Here's how a Field Accounting Manager for PCL Construction, Inc. within Civil West contributes to our team:
Responsibilities
- All responsibilities related to FAM 1 apply to projects of high complexity.
- Monitors and approves the daily/weekly/monthly/yearly accounting functions such as accounts payable, accounts receivable, payroll, and others as required, in accordance with legislative, contract terms, and PCL policy and procedures.
- Assists the accounting manager or field business manager with the implementation and monitoring for adherence to district/company administration and accounting policies and procedures to ensure continued effectiveness at the project level.
- Provides various ad hoc reports and analysis, then presents information to accounting manager, field business manager, and/or project team.
- Prepares, reviews, and analyzes all month-end and year-end project reporting. Raises any issues, problems, or discrepancies with accounting manager and/or field business manager.
- Assists with assembling information for internal financial reporting requirements (e.g., MOR, DRM/year-end) and external financial reporting requirements (e.g., government agencies, taxes).
- Prepares bank deposits and/or monthly reconciliations and prepares subsequent cash receipt entries where required.
- Works with operations management and accounting manager to effectively analyze and manage project cash-flow and provides recommendations accordingly.
- Responsible for ensuring that all required documentation, including insurance, bonding, SDI, workers compensation, statutory declarations, and lien waivers is in place and renewed accordingly.
- Works closely with the project team members to provide general guidance and expertise on contract/subcontracts, including interpretation of contract/ subcontract documents.
- Oversees and is accountable for the setup, maintenance, adjustments, and monitoring of all project accounting processes and procedures as required.
Qualifications
- Undergraduate degree or diploma in a related discipline.
- Active pursuit of accounting designation an asset.
- 6 years of progressive experience with direct project administration and accounting in the construction or a related industry preferred. On-site project experience preferred.
- 1 to 2 years of supervisory experience preferred.
- Advanced construction knowledge; understands general construction terms and processes.
- Advanced knowledge and understanding of full-cycle accounting, with the ability to teach and mentor more junior staff. Advanced understanding of accounting principles, including maintenance of ledgers and cash-flows, with ability to analyze and recommend potential strategies.
- Advanced understanding of project forecasting and budgeting.
- Advanced knowledge of project costing principles, recoveries, insurance, and contract/subcontract requirements as related to accounting.
- Understands and complies with all labor agreements, government legislation, and PCL policies and procedures.
- Advanced knowledge of government legislation regarding accounting and applicable generally accepted accounting practices and standards.
- Understanding of Lean principles and process improvement.
- Intermediate knowledge of bid and contract securities and insurance as they relate to risk management, claims management, pricing, and accounting.
- Advanced understanding of subcontract PO terms, including insurance and subcontractor default insurance (SDI) and bonding requirements.
